
Kerala Chief Minister Pinarayi Vijayan inaugurated the first phase of the Wayanad Model Township on March 1, 2026, handing over 178 new homes and land titles to survivors of the July 2024 Mundakkai-Chooralmala landslides. The township, designed as a self-contained community with essential amenities, aims to rehabilitate 410 families displaced by the disaster. The government emphasized overcoming challenges, including denial of central aid and misinformation, to complete this major rehabilitation effort before the next monsoon.
